Comprehending the Associate Degree Path in Nursing
An associate level in nursing supplies the structure you need to enter the occupation fairly promptly contrasted to conventional four-year programs. This educational track typically takes 2 to 3 years to complete and prepares you for the National Council Licensure Examination, typically called the NCLEX-RN. Passing this test certifies you to function as a signed up nurse in Texas and beyond.
The curriculum incorporates class instruction with hands-on scientific experience. You'll study anatomy, physiology, pharmacology, and person treatment methods while getting real-world experience in health care setups. This balanced method ensures you create both the academic understanding and functional skills employers value.
Several students pick this path since it provides a much faster entry point right into the workforce. You can begin making a nursing wage and gaining specialist experience earlier than if you pursued a bachelor's level initially. Later, you can advance your education and learning while functioning, with several hospitals providing tuition aid programs for employees looking for greater degrees.

Fulfilling Prerequisite Requirements
Nursing programs preserve certain admission requirements that you must please prior to starting the core curriculum. Most programs need conclusion of prerequisite training courses in subjects like makeup, physiology, microbiology, chemistry, and psychology. These fundamental programs prepare you for the rigorous nursing curriculum ahead.
You can complete prerequisites at community universities or through on-line carriers, though you need to confirm that your picked nursing program will approve credit reports from these resources. Taking prerequisites part-time while working permits you to preserve your earnings while making progress toward your objective. This technique works well for many Baytown citizens stabilizing family members responsibilities and employment.
Several programs likewise require entry examinations such as the Test of Essential Academic Skills, which examines your preparedness for college-level science and healthcare coursework. Preparing thoroughly for these tests boosts your chances of approval into affordable programs. Research overviews, practice examinations, and preparation training courses can enhance your efficiency dramatically.
Background checks and wellness testings stand for additional demands you'll experience. Clinical centers require assurance that trainees position no risk to prone clients. You'll need existing immunization records, TB screening, and possibly medication testing prior to beginning scientific rotations. Planning for these demands early protects against hold-ups in your development.
Discovering Financial Aid Options
Nursing education stands for a significant economic investment, however countless resources exist to help you handle prices. Federal financial assistance with the Free Application for Federal Student Aid supplies accessibility to grants, lendings, and work-study possibilities based upon your economic circumstance. Finishing this application opens doors to different funding resources simultaneously.
Texas provides state-specific grants and scholarships for nursing trainees, acknowledging the vital requirement for medical care specialists. The Texas Armed Services Scholarship Program and the Vocational Nursing Student Grant Program assistance eligible students seeking medical care jobs. Research these possibilities extensively, as application deadlines and eligibility standards differ.
Neighborhood healthcare facilities sometimes use scholarship programs or tuition reimbursement contracts. These plans normally need you to commit to working for the organization after graduation for a given period. While this dedication restricts your prompt job flexibility, it can substantially decrease your educational financial debt and assurance work upon licensure.
Army professionals might get approved for education and learning advantages via the GI Bill, which can cover substantial parts of tuition and give living gratuities. The Yellow Ribbon Program expands added support at getting involved establishments. If you've served or have family members who offered, checking out these benefits could dramatically lower your out-of-pocket expenditures.

Preparing for NCLEX Success
The NCLEX-RN assessment stands between you and your nursing permit. This computerized adaptive examination evaluates your preparedness to practice safely and properly as an entry-level registered nurse. Your nursing program prepares you for this test throughout your coursework, but specialized NCLEX prep work during your last term shows valuable.
Review programs, question banks, and study hall aid many trainees really feel more certain approaching the examination. These sources acquaint you with the test style and inquiry designs while identifying understanding spaces you require to resolve. Consistent, focused study over a number of weeks normally generates better results than cramming promptly prior to the test.
Recognizing the examination's flexible nature aids take care of anxiousness on test day. The computer system readjusts inquiry trouble based upon your feedbacks, so encountering challenging questions does not necessarily indicate bad performance. Maintaining calmness and meticulously reading each question boosts your opportunities of success.
Scheduling your test within 45 days of graduation assists make sure the product continues to be fresh in your mind. Lots of states, consisting of Texas, allow you to request licensure prior to taking the NCLEX, which accelerates the procedure of starting your nursing career. You can function as a graduate nurse under supervision in some centers while awaiting your results.

Growing Your Nursing Career
Your associate's level opens doors to prompt employment, but it likewise functions as a stepping stone towards advanced opportunities. Many signed up nurses return to school for bachelor's or master's degrees while working. Online and crossbreed programs made for functioning nurses make this development possible without leaving your job.
Bridge programs specifically made for nurses with associate degrees enhance the path to greater qualifications. RN-to-BSN programs usually take 12 to 18 months when pursued permanent, though part-time choices accommodate functioning nurses. These programs concentrate on management, study, and neighborhood wellness principles that prepare you for expanded roles.
Field of expertise certifications improve your know-how and earning possible in areas like essential care, emergency situation nursing, or oncology. Many qualifications require a minimal quantity of medical experience in the specialized area, so working initially enables you to discover different fields prior to committing to expertise.
Management positions such as charge registered nurse, registered nurse manager, or medical instructor become available as you obtain experience and education. These roles enable you to affect person care high quality, coach more recent registered nurses, and shape healthcare shipment in your company.
